    CUET Physics Chapter-wise Weightage (Based on 2025 Paper)

    A clear understanding of CUET 2025 Physics chapter-wise weightage can help students focus on the most relevant units instead of revising the entire syllabus randomly. This type of topic mapping is useful for students who want to know which chapters are most important in CUET 2026 Physics, where the paper was easier, and which units require the most revision time.

    Chapter Name

    No. of Questions

    Weightage (%)

    Difficulty Trend

    Preparation Priority

    Electrostatics

    8

    16%

    Mostly Easy

    Very High

    Optics

    8

    16%

    Easy to Medium

    Very High

    Current Electricity

    7

    14%

    Easy to Medium

    Very High

    Electromagnetic Induction and Alternating Currents

    7

    14%

    Easy to Medium

    Very High

    Magnetic Effects of Current and Magnetism

    6

    12%

    Easy to Medium

    High

    Atoms and Nuclei

    4

    8%

    Easy to Medium

    High

    Electromagnetic Waves

    3

    6%

    Mostly Easy

    Medium

    Dual Nature of Matter and Radiation

    3

    6%

    Easy to Medium

    Medium

    Electronic Devices

    3

    6%

    Mostly Easy

    Medium

    Properties of Solids and Liquids

    1

    2%

    Easy

    Low

    CUET Chemistry Chapter-wise Weightage (Based on 2025 Paper)

    A clear understanding of CUET 2025 Chemistry chapter-wise weightage helps students focus on the most relevant topics instead of revising the entire syllabus without direction. This type of analysis enables students to identify which are high weightage Chemistry chapters for CUET 2026, understand the overall exam trend, and determine where to allocate more revision time for improved scoring outcomes.

    Chapter Name

    No. of Questions

    Weightage (%)

    Difficulty Trend

    Preparation Priority

    Organic Compounds containing Oxygen

    10

    20.83%

    Mostly Medium

    Very High

    Electrochemistry

    5

    10.42%

    Easy to Medium

    High

    Biomolecules

    5

    10.42%

    Easy to Medium

    High

    Organic Compounds containing Halogens

    5

    10.42%

    Medium to Difficult

    High

    Solutions

    5

    10.42%

    Mostly Easy

    High

    Coordination Compounds

    4

    8.33%

    Easy to Medium

    High

    Chemical Kinetics

    4

    8.33%

    Mostly Medium

    High

    d - and f - BLOCK ELEMENTS

    5

    10.42%

    Easy to Medium

    High

    Organic Compounds containing Nitrogen

    3

    6.25%

    Easy to Medium

    Moderate

    Surface Chemistry

    1

    2.08%

    Easy

    Low


    CUET Maths Chapter-wise Weightage (Based on 2025 Paper)

    A clear understanding of CUET 2025 Maths chapter-wise weightage helps students focus on the most relevant topics instead of revising the entire syllabus without direction. This type of analysis allows students to identify which Maths chapters are most important for CUET, understand the overall exam trend, and decide where to invest more revision time for better scoring outcomes.

    Chapter Name

    No. of Questions

    Weightage (%)

    Difficulty Trend

    Preparation Priority

    Matrices & Determinants

    10

    20%

    Easy to Medium

    Very High

    Integrals

    9

    18%

    Mostly Medium

    Very High

    Continuity and Differentiability

    6

    12%

    Mostly Medium

    Very High

    Vector Algebra

    6

    12%

    Easy to Medium

    High

    Differential Equations

    5

    10%

    Mostly Medium

    High

    Probability

    5

    10%

    Mostly Medium

    High

    Linear Programming (LPP)

    2

    4%

    Easy

    Moderate

    Applications of Derivatives

    2

    4%

    Medium

    Moderate

    Relations and Functions

    2

    4%

    Easy to Medium

    Moderate

    Linear Inequalities

    1

    2%

    Easy

    Low

    Three-Dimensional Geometry

    1

    2%

    Medium

    Low

    Inverse Trigonometric Functions

    1

    2%

    Easy

    Low

    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

    Q: Is NCERT enough for CUET 2026 PCM?
    A:

    Yes, NCERT is the base for Physics, Chemistry, and Maths, but students should also practice PYQs and mocks for better accuracy.

    Q: How many chapters should I finish first for CUET 2026 PCM?
    A:

    Students should first complete the top 4 to 5 high-weightage chapters in each subject for better score coverage.

    Q: Which subject is easiest to score in for CUET PCM?
    A:

    Chemistry is usually the most scoring, while Maths needs more practice and Physics needs strong concept clarity.

    Q: Should I revise chapter-wise or solve mocks first?
    A:

    Start with chapter-wise revision and PYQs first, then move to full mock tests.

    Q: What should I do if one PCM subject is weak?
    A:

    Focus only on high-weightage and repeated topics first instead of trying to complete everything.
